Grant opportunity for charitable organizations in Virginia to purchase and distribute Virginia Grown agricultural products to food insecure persons. Applications due May 5, 2026.
The Virginia Agriculture Food Assistance Program will provide grants to charitable food assistance organizations to purchase Virginia Grown agricultural products. These products must be distributed to food insecure persons in Virginia in accordance with the food distribution guidelines for each charitable food assistance organization. VDACS will award funds for a grant period of up to one year in lengthApplicants must submit applications through the VDACS website at: https://www.vdacs.virginia.gov/virginia-agriculture-food-assistance-program.shtmlby 5:00 p.m. Eastern Time on Tuesday, May 5, 2026.
